我正在使用react-tooltip模块(https://www.npmjs.com/package/react-tooltip),
无法弄清楚如何在一定时间(例如 5 秒)后隐藏提示
我试过这个:
<ReactTooltip afterShow={() => { setTimeout(ReactTooltip.hide(), 5000) }} />
Run Code Online (Sandbox Code Playgroud)
但在这种情况下,工具提示甚至不会显示
小智 5
您不必()在方法后面使用括号,只需放置方法的链接,如下所示:
setTimeout(ReactTooltip.hide, 5000)
Run Code Online (Sandbox Code Playgroud)
但在这种情况下,工具提示甚至不会显示,因为ReactTooltip.hide()在显示工具提示后立即调用您的方法
| 归档时间: |
|
| 查看次数: |
3767 次 |
| 最近记录: |